SEBUYAU: A total of 3,000 runners took part in the Batang Lupar Bridge 1 Half Marathon 2026 today (July 12), showcasing the iconic bridge while promoting healthy living and sports tourism in Sarawak.

Sarawak Deputy Minister for Infrastructure and Port Development Datuk Aidel Lariwoo flagged off the 10km and 5km categories on behalf of Deputy Premier Datuk Amar Douglas Uggah Embas, while Sarawak Public Works Department (PWD) director Datuk Cassidy Morris earlier flagged off the 21km race.

The event featured three categories comprising 21km, 10km and 5km, attracting 596 participants in the half marathon, 776 in the 10km race and 1,628 in the 5km event.

Held on the Batang Lupar 1 Bridge, recognised by the Malaysia Book of Records as the country’s longest river crossing bridge, the event gave participants from across the country the rare opportunity to run on one of Sarawak’s landmark infrastructure projects.

The marathon also reflected the Sarawak Government’s and PWD Sarawak’s commitment to leveraging world class infrastructure to promote sports tourism, strengthen community engagement and support the state’s economic growth.
